Health and Community Services
As a Health Policy Analyst in the Department of Health and Community Services, Danny Barrett goes above and beyond the scope of his position each and every day.
Danny has the gift of leading an initiative while making team members feel valued and respected. He led the province-wide public information sessions on the Personal Health Information Act. He has also been a key player in significant files such as the Adult Dental Program and the Adult Protection Act. He sees beyond the goal of creating legislation, policies, programs and services. He has a deep appreciation and understanding of how these components are interconnected, their significance in the decision-making process, and the importance of input and sharing.
Working in a fast paced, high-stress environment, with constant deadlines, Danny sets the highest standards for himself and always strives to achieve them. His commitment comes partly from his training as a social worker, partly from his work ethic and partly from the profound respect he has for the public service. His work is of the highest calibre. He understands and supports transparency and accountability and applies these principles to everything that he does. For example, when responding to requests for child protection records, Danny recognizes the nature of the information being sought and is sensitive to the potential impact it may have on the lives of the people involved. He goes out of his way to support the applicant throughout the process – an act that is greatly appreciated.
Danny truly believes in collaboration and is a dedicated supporter of creating positive workplaces, and a society, that are inclusive. He continuously makes his department and government proud with everything he does. With a strong social conscience and the ability to adapt to any situation, Danny exemplifies excellence in public service.
